The iPad mini gets the stuff from the iPhone 5 and a Retina. Let's hope the 5's processor is good enough for Retina.

It's not. The A6 will not be in a Retina Mini. It doesn't have the memory bandwidth to support a 2048x1536 resolution, which is a big part of the A5X and A6X designs.

I mean what's in the mini right now? The 4 or 4S' processor? What was in the iPad 3 that made it so bad at running the screen?

The iPad mini has the iPad 2's A5 chip; the iPad 3 has an A5X, which is a tweaked A5 with more graphic horsepower - however, not enough horsepower to drive a 2048x1536 display as well as the iPad 2 could push 1024x768.
